had someone email me asking why certain channels don't clear,

Heat
Magic
Kerrang
Vintage TV
Vevo

i tried them on my box and they wouldn't clear for me either.

opened up the white box next to the tv which contains a big, box type tratec splitter tris-102a

i've just swapped it out for a new voxcom one and all the channels bar kerrang are back :-)

cable can be a pain in the ass ;-)

In terms of problem solving, I had a few channels missing never hit the service scan. Tried various things including decent high quality splitters.

In the end bought a HDU thanks to advise from another member.

So if your signal is too strong and you get picture break up you may need an attenuator. If your signal is too weak as in my case HDU solved issue. Hope others find this helpful.

Sorry to ask but not sure what a HDU is ?
 
HDU is basically a much better way of splitting your cable signal if its weak. High Def Unit. there are various ones all depends on how many ports you need and if you want an in-home or outside model. the in home goes after the white box.HDU-400 PIC 1.jpg
 
Ok thanks for the info, i never heard of them before.

Is there an easy way to tell if your signal is too weak or too strong ?

Thanks.
 
Not sure if there is an easy way to tell signal strength. maybe there's some sort of test meter that does that? When I couldn't get some channels I plugged my Vu box in direct from the cable coming off the white box and those channels worked, so I knew the problem was due to the splitter not being powerful enough to cope with demand till I bought the HDU.
